Abstract

A method for synthesizing .DELTA..sup.3 -7-substituted amino desacetoxy cephalosporanic acid from a penicillin sulfoxide or its alkylsilylated ester derivative is provided. According to the method, penicillin sulfoxide is heated in the presence of an organic ammonium salt catalyst and a copolymer composed of dimethylsilane and urea units until formation of the cephalosporanic acid occurs by ring expansion reaction. The copolymer functions both as a dehydrating agent for removing the water by-product generated from the reaction as well as an esterifying agent for converting penicillin sulfoxide into its dimethylsilyl ester derivative. The method of the invention produces high yields of the cephalosporanic acid and avoids the need for excess dimethylsilyating agents.
